Hello,

I want to add handwriting notes/markings/encirclement over documents mostly ebooks in .doc, .rtf , .pdf that i read, i've copy a lot of them on my micro SD card.

So if i open a .doc with POLARIS (feel free to make better recommendation) in reading mode it lets me to make diffrent handwriting over text, when i exit it says document has been modified - i select SAVE, but if i open again the file all my notes are gone. In Editing mode there's no feature to handwrite, i mean not marking, just to add text, tables,pictures.

Can you please give me some advice or recommend another replacement ? From what I have experienced, when you use the S-Pen in screen write mode, which is what it takes to mark up anything , docs, screens, etc, what it does is take a screenshot of whatever you are looking at. Once you mark it up, and save it, it saves it as an image, and you can find it in your pictures > screenshots folder.

Others have also commented on other apps that let you do notes and stuff on pdf docs,

Hope that helps, at least some.

I had the exact same issue, wasted hours on trying to get Polaris to work with Word documents generated in Win 7 and then marking them up in the Samsung Note. Those markups could be nicely done in Polaris, but they could not be seen when the files were then examined on Win 7 machines by my colleagues, which for me defeated the purpose. Finally concluded that the easiest thing to do (for me) was to take my Word documents in my laptop, export them as PDFs and mail them to my Samsung, mark them up in RepligoReader, then mail them to the intended recipient. The markups (which I do by "drawing on them" with the S-Pen, like old-school manuscript marking up - love it!) are preserved on the PDFs that others can see in Win 7. My group emails me several hundred page Word documents for marking up and this works well; used it over the break and marked up three documents this way.

This solution may not be suitable for you.

I had the same problem but now know how to get around it. Try opening the file again with "fox it pdf" app. The handwritings re-appeared for me.
Situation 1: edited in polaris->opened in polaris and adobe, does not show the edit. opened foxit, edit shows up.
Situation 2: edited in foxitpdf->opened in adobe and foxit->shows the edit. Opened in polaris, does not show the edit.

Fox it however does not allow you to type on the pdf :((.. so I guess I will switch back and forth....

You need an editor that flattens the resulting pdf and most do not do a good job. If you work extensively with pdf files, Lecture Notes is it.
